About 4-oxo-3-phenylmethoxy-5,6,7,8-tetrahydropyrazolo[1,5-a][1,4]diazepine-2-carboxylic acid
4-oxo-3-phenylmethoxy-5,6,7,8-tetrahydropyrazolo[1,5-a][1,4]diazepine-2-carboxylic acid (PubChem CID 68952685) has the molecular formula C15H15N3O4
and a molecular weight of 301.30 g/mol. Its IUPAC name is 4-oxo-3-phenylmethoxy-5,6,7,8-tetrahydropyrazolo[1,5-a][1,4]diazepine-2-carboxylic acid.

What is the SMILES notation for 4-oxo-3-phenylmethoxy-5,6,7,8-tetrahydropyrazolo[1,5-a][1,4]diazepine-2-carboxylic acid?
The canonical SMILES for 4-oxo-3-phenylmethoxy-5,6,7,8-tetrahydropyrazolo[1,5-a][1,4]diazepine-2-carboxylic acid is O=C(O)c1nn2c(c1OCc1ccccc1)C(=O)NCCC2.
What is the InChIKey of 4-oxo-3-phenylmethoxy-5,6,7,8-tetrahydropyrazolo[1,5-a][1,4]diazepine-2-carboxylic acid?
The InChIKey is QYICSIXHRFLTII-UHFFFAOYSA-N. The full InChI is InChI=1S/C15H15N3O4/c19-14-12-13(22-9-10-5-2-1-3-6-10)11(15(20)21)17-18(12)8-4-7-16-14/h1-3,5-6H,4,7-9H2,(H,16,19)(H,20,21).
What are the key properties of 4-oxo-3-phenylmethoxy-5,6,7,8-tetrahydropyrazolo[1,5-a][1,4]diazepine-2-carboxylic acid?
4-oxo-3-phenylmethoxy-5,6,7,8-tetrahydropyrazolo[1,5-a][1,4]diazepine-2-carboxylic acid has a molecular weight of 301.30 g/mol, XLogP of 1.29, 4 rotatable bonds, 2 hydrogen bond donors, and 5 hydrogen bond acceptors.
